    The Life of a Systems Analyst

    A System Analyst is a person who uses analysis and design techniques to solve business problems using information technology. They are responsible for maintaining and improving computer systems for an organization and its clients.

    The Life of a Technical Project Manager

    A Technical Project Manager ensures that the technical projects of a company are executed successfully. Doing so involves managing a team, interacting with clients & stakeholders, communicating requirements, tracking data & budget, setting schedules, defining scope & deliverables, and more.

    The Life of a Quality Assurance Manager

    Quality Assurance (QA) managers help organizations establish quality regulations for products and services. Their job varies day-to-day and every company/project has its own culture, required skills, and job duties/responsibilities.
